They are heading west to compete with teams from 15 countries and most every state. They are our own Team New Hampshire (or #TeamNH) representing the Granite State at Destination Imagination Global Finals 2025. These talented students from Bedford, Grantham, Mascoma, Oyster River, and Windham showcased exceptional creativity, collaboration, teamwork, and innovation at the recent Destination Imagination state tournaments, securing their spots to represent the Granite State.

Destination Imagination Global Finals is a culmination of a year of teamwork and challenge-solving by over 125,000 students globally, and over 800 in New Hampshire. Held this year in Kansas City, MO., hundreds of teams from 15 counties and most states will be competing at Global Finals. There will also be time for the teams to interact, share, and learn from other teams at the largest academic competition of its kind.

Destination Imagination challenges teams to develop creative solutions to complex, STEAM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, and Mathematics)-based or Service Learning challenges. The New Hampshire teams demonstrated remarkable ingenuity in designing and presenting their solutions, impressing the appraisers with their problem-solving skills and effective creativity and collaboration.
